There's a problem with the Author Search facility. Many of us aren't showing up at all as belonging to the Africa: South Africa region, let alone even being registered for Nano.
However ... according to the Tech Help forum, there is a solution.
If you go in and change your home region to none, then go back and change your home region to what it should be - you will then start showing up in the search list by location.
I tried this and, voila, I'm listed. Maybe, given my lowly word count, I shouldn't have bothered.
At least now you know what to do if you want to find who your closest rival *cof* friend, is.
